College Major for Tech VC
I would like to go into tech VC, however I am not sure what I should major in. Since comp sci/engineering is becoming the major for tech, I might major in that. However, can I major in economics and still break in? Is a comp sci background necessary for VC now?
Why not major in both? That'll logically be the best preparation. Tech VC is quite a broad definition- engineering would be better for some things, comp sci for others. Keep in mind that to get to VC you often (if not always) need to go through something like IB, and having an economics/finance major could make that easier.
Comp Sci or EE plus finance is the ideal mix
